Responsibilities of the Software Developer
- Develop and maintain software applications using C#, ASP.NET Core, ASP.NET Framework, Blazor, MAUI and Web API technologies.
- Design and optimise database solutions, ETL processes and data integration workflows across multiple platforms.
- Support Power BI environments, data warehousing initiatives and integration development projects.
- Collaborate with stakeholders to deliver robust technical solutions while following development best practices and Agile methodologies.
Requirements of the Software Developer
- Proven experience developing applications using C#, ASP.NET Core, ASP.NET Framework, Blazor, MAUI and Web API.
- Strong SQL skills including T-SQL, PL/SQL, database design and performance optimisation.
- Experience with SSIS, data warehousing concepts and integration platforms such as Boomi and Power BI administration.
- Excellent problem solving, communication and stakeholder management skills with the ability to work independently and collaboratively.

How to prepare for a job interview at Cathedral Appointments Ltd
✨Know Your Tech Stack
Make sure you’re well-versed in the technologies mentioned in the job description, like C#, ASP.NET Core, and Blazor. Brush up on your SQL skills too, as they’ll likely ask you about database design and performance optimisation.
✨Showcase Problem-Solving Skills
Prepare to discuss specific examples where you've tackled complex technical challenges. Use the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result) to structure your answers and highlight your problem-solving abilities.
✨Understand Agile Methodologies
Since the role involves following development best practices and Agile methodologies, be ready to talk about your experience with Agile. Share how you’ve collaborated with teams and stakeholders in past projects to deliver successful outcomes.
✨Ask Insightful Questions
At the end of the interview, don’t forget to ask questions! Inquire about the team dynamics, ongoing projects, or how success is measured in this role. This shows your genuine interest and helps you gauge if the company is the right fit for you.
